So, to elaborate a bit more on what's changed, there's now a way to check your personal status within Shield High. It's like the three parts at the bottom of every NPC's relationships thing, but with one new stat. As well as power there's PERCEIVED POWER. Basically, power changes when something tangible happens. You obtain a new slave, you win a fight, that sort of thing. It shows how much stuff you can ACTUALLY do, how likely you are to win fights, and things like that. Your perceived power however is what everyone THINKS you can do. It fluctuates a lot more, climbing from resisting girls pressuring you to submit, or winning fights, or even just starting them, even with no follow through. Likewise it drops when you submit, or lose, or anything else like that.

This matters because the static story events, such as Stacy and Carmen will only trigger when your Perceived Power reaches a certain level. Currently that's 20 and 30 for Stacy and Carmen respectively, however it will be changed to 40 for Carmen when the game is a bit bigger. To make things easier on you until saving is properly fixed and overhauled and things, you can simply submit to Karen, which instead of dropping you by 2 points, ups you by 20, putting you in range to get one story, then the other quite quickly.
